WebThe cosine function is an even function because cos( − θ) = cos θ. For example, consider corresponding inputs π 4 and − π 4. The output of cos(π 4) is the same as the output of cos(− π 4). So if you take the trigonometric … WebEvery cosine has period 2π. Figure 4.3 shows two even functions, the repeating ramp RR(x)andtheup-down train UD(x) of delta functions. That sawtooth ramp RR is the integral of the square wave. The delta functions in UD give the derivative of the square wave. (For sines, the integral and derivative are cosines.)

WebThe cosine function cos x is also periodic over the period length T = 2 π (see Fig. 3.4a ). It is mirror-symmetric to x = 0 and is therefore referred to as an even function.
